The Wolseley – A Taste of European Grandeur
Housed in an elegant 1920s building, The Wolseley offers a timeless experience that brings the charm of European café-restaurant culture to the heart of London. Its menu features a blend of classic European dishes, served in a space that exudes old-world charm with high ceilings, chic monochrome tiling, and an atmosphere that transitions from lively mornings to intimate evenings. Whether enjoying a leisurely breakfast or a sophisticated dinner, The Wolseley never fails to impress with its impeccable service and refined elegance.
Bentley’s Oyster Bar & Grill – A Seafood Tradition
Located just off Piccadilly, Bentley’s has been serving exquisite seafood for over a century. Specializing in oysters and fresh fish, Bentley’s presents the best of Britain’s seafood with an emphasis on simplicity and quality. The restaurant’s Victorian-style design, complete with an open grill and outdoor terrace, creates a relaxed yet refined ambiance. A favorite of seafood lovers and Piccadilly regulars alike, Bentley’s is the perfect place to indulge in fresh, expertly prepared seafood.
Le Caprice – Contemporary British Dining at its Best
For a true taste of British cuisine with a modern twist, Le Caprice is a must-visit. Tucked behind the Royal Academy of Arts, this chic and stylish restaurant serves a menu that blends traditional British flavors with international influences. The black-and-white interior, complemented by live piano music, creates a sophisticated atmosphere that’s perfect for any occasion. From seasonal British dishes to an extensive wine list, Le Caprice has earned its place as a favorite among both locals and tourists.
Piccolino – A Flavorful Escape to Italy
For a taste of Italy in the heart of Piccadilly, Piccolino is the place to go. Offering a lively and inviting atmosphere, this Italian restaurant is perfect for a casual lunch or dinner. The menu features handmade pastas, fresh seafood, and wood-fired pizzas, all prepared with the finest seasonal ingredients. The outdoor dining area, especially popular during the warmer months, allows guests to enjoy authentic Italian flavors while soaking up the energy of Piccadilly.
